Decade path · College Scorecard
One campus shows net-price relief; the peer does not
NET-SPLIT · 2013–2023
Over 2013–2023, only one school has a directional decline in average net price; the other stays a measured range. Cost gaps on this board are moving targets, not fixed snapshot deltas.
- Touro University: average net price rose +94.6% from $13,646 (2013) to $26,556 (2023), r² 0.51.
- University of Illinois Chicago: average net price fell -9.1% from $13,545 (2013) to $12,313 (2023), r² 0.59.
- University of Illinois Chicago: acceptance-rate path 2013–2023 stays non-directional here (r² 0.35).
- Touro University: acceptance rate eased +7.4% across 2013–2023 (r² 0.40).
College Scorecard institution series; dollars are nominal. Direction claims require r² ≥ 0.40 on the fitted annual slope, otherwise the page reports the observed range. Descriptive history, not a recommendation.

| Metric | University of Illinois Chicago Chicago, IL | Touro University New York, NY |
| Location | Chicago, IL | New York, NY |
| Type | Public | Private Nonprofit |
| Undergraduate Enrollment | 22,170 | 4,040 |
| Avg Net Price | $10,974 | $29,627 |
| In-State Tuition | $14,338 | $22,450 |
| Out-of-State Tuition | $29,884 | $22,450 |
| Loan Repayment Rate (Completers) | 76.4% | 57.8% |
| Median Earnings (10 yr) | $68,740 | $53,419 |
| Acceptance Rate | 77.3% | 60.8% |
| Median Earnings (6 yr) | $53,218 | $43,510 |
| 150%-Time Completion | 61.0% | 68.4% |
Rows ordered by relative gap on this pair. Teal = better side. College Scorecard.
